Family Friendly 3-Day Itinerary in Haridwar

Friday, August 18: Exploring the Spiritual Heritage

Start your trip by visiting the Har Ki Pauri ghat in the morning. This sacred bathing ghat on the banks of the Ganges River is believed to be the spot where Lord Vishnu left his footprint. Witness the mesmerizing Ganga Aarti ceremony, a spiritual ritual of worshiping the river with music and lights, in the evening. Afterward, take a walk along the bustling streets of Haridwar and savor delicious street food, such as aloo puri and jalebi.

  • Har Ki Pauri Ghat: Free, 2 hours
  • Ganga Aarti Ceremony: Free, 1.5 hours
  • Street Food: INR 200 (approx.), 1 hour
Saturday, August 19: Nature and Wildlife

Embark on a morning visit to Rajaji National Park, just a short drive from Haridwar. Explore the park's diverse flora and fauna through a jeep safari and keep an eye out for elephants, tigers, leopards, and various bird species. Afterward, visit Chandi Devi Temple, perched atop Neel Parvat, accessible via a scenic cable car ride. Enjoy the panoramic views of Haridwar from the temple premises. In the evening, take a leisurely stroll along the picturesque Motichur Forest Road.

  • Rajaji National Park: INR 500 (approx.), 4 hours
  • Chandi Devi Temple: INR 360 (approx.), 2 hours
  • Motichur Forest Road: Free, 1 hour
Sunday, August 20: Cultural Heritage and Adventure

Start your day with a visit to the iconic Mansa Devi Temple, located atop Bilwa Parvat. Reach the temple by either taking a cable car or trekking up the hill. Explore the temple complex and enjoy the serene atmosphere. Afterward, head to the nearby Rishikesh for an adventurous experience of river rafting in the Ganges. Feel the adrenaline rush as you navigate through the rapids. In the evening, witness the mesmerizing Ganga Aarti ceremony at Parmarth Niketan Ashram in Rishikesh.

  • Mansa Devi Temple: INR 200 (approx.), 2 hours
  • River Rafting in Rishikesh: INR 1500 (approx.), 4 hours
  • Ganga Aarti at Parmarth Niketan Ashram: Free, 1.5 hours

Hidden Gems and Local Favorites

When in Haridwar, don't miss out on visiting the nearby Neel Dhara Pakshi Vihar, a bird sanctuary where you can spot various migratory and resident bird species. It's a great place for birdwatching and offers a tranquil escape from the hustle and bustle of the city. Another local favorite is the Haridwar Market, where you can shop for traditional handicrafts, jewelry, and Ayurvedic products. Make sure to try the famous Haridwar sweets, such as peda and barfi, which make for delightful souvenirs.
